Scheming

tipu daya
definition
verb
he schemed to bring about the collapse of the government
make plans, especially in a devious way or with intent to do something illegal or wrong.
noun
He doubted she would be there, considering they were practically done with their scheming , but he was willing to hope for anything.
the activity or practice of making secret or underhanded plans.
adjective
they had mean, scheming little minds
given to or involved in making secret and underhanded plans.
